StrictMath.Hypot(Double, Double) 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
返回 sqrt(x<sup 2</sup>> +y<sup>2</sup>),不带中间溢出或下溢。
[Android.Runtime.Register("hypot", "(DD)D", "")]
public static double Hypot (double x, double y);
[<Android.Runtime.Register("hypot", "(DD)D", "")>]
static member Hypot : double * double -> double
参数
- x
- Double
值
- y
- Double
值
返回
sqrt(x<sup 2</sup>> +y<sup>2</sup>) 没有中间溢出或下溢
- 属性
注解
返回 sqrt(x<sup 2</sup>> +y<sup>2</sup>),不带中间溢出或下溢。
特殊情况: <ul>
<li> 如果任一参数为无限,则结果为正无穷大。
<li> 如果任一参数为 NaN 且两个参数都不为无限,则结果为 NaN。
<li> 如果两个参数均为零,则结果为正零。 </ul>
在 1.5 中添加。
适用于 . 的 java.lang.StrictMath.hypot(double, double)
Java 文档
本页的某些部分是根据 Android 开放源代码项目创建和共享的工作进行的修改,并根据 Creative Commons 2.5 属性许可证中所述的术语使用。